About the AuthorNorvel Hayes is a successful b u s i n e s s m a n ,

internationally renowned Bible teacher, andfounder of several Christian ministries in the U.S.and abroad.

Brother Hayes founded New Life Bible C o l l e g e ,located in Cleveland, Tennessee, in 1977. New LifeBible Church grew out of the Bible school’s chapelservices. The Bible School offers a two-yeardiploma and off-campus correspondence courses.Among it’s many other out-reaches, the churchministers God’s Word and hot meals daily to thepoor through the New Life Soup Kitchen.

Brother Hayes is also the founder andpresident of New Life Maternity Home, a ministrydedicated to the spiritual, physical and financialneed of young girls during pregnancy; C a m p u sChallenge, and evangelistic outreach thatdistributes Christian literature on collegecampuses across America; Street Reach, a ministrydedicated to runaway teens located in DaytonaBeach, Florida; and Children’s Home, an orphanagehome and education center located in India.

Known internationally for his dynamicexposition of the Word of God, Brother Hayesspends most of his time teaching and ministeringGod’s deliverance and healing power in churches,college classrooms, conventions and seminarsaround the world.
